Hi guys, In the draft, it says: Each network device receives the Path Tracking packet from its upstream device, makes a copy of it and passes the copy to its CPU.
That means the OAM packet will have different data path with the normal packet. The normal packet will not have "copy" action in the datapath. Then how could the OAM packet detect the liveness of the datapath? Did I missed something?
